     Hatten P. Lawrence was buried at Lawrence Cemetery, in a field off Aglar Drive, near Stonewall Community on Rt. 221, Floyd Co., Virginia.3 He was born on June 4, 1892 at Floyd Co., Virginia.1 He married Laodus Alpha Cannaday, daughter of Andrew Luther Cannaday and Nora Dell Aldridge, on November 24, 1918 at Floyd Co., Virginia.4 Hatten P. Lawrence died on September 25, 1936 at Beckley, Raleigh Co., West Virginia, at age 44.1,2 He Funeral services for H. B. Lawrence, who committed suicide 12 hours after he lost his job in a Stolesbury mine, are to be held at 1 o'clock today at Floyd, Va. The Rev. James Richardson, of the Floyd Baptist church, is to conduct services at the cemetery. Lawrence a 42-year-old resident of Church street, had been working at the mine power-house 18 years and returned home Friday morning to tell his family he had been paid off and fired. That evening he was found with a bullet through his right temple and a .22 caliber automatic rifle lying by his feet. City and state police pronounced it a suicide at an inquest. Mrs. Lawrence, sitting with her two daughters in the living room, heard the shot after her husband had been sharpening circular saw in the basement. She ran downstairs to see "what was wrong with daddy," and found him dead. Besides his widow, he leaves two daughters, Gladys 16, and Helen, 14, students in Beckley schools. on September 27, 1936.2
